مرحباً
تم دمج منتدى discourse الخاص بي مع موقعي الإلكتروني باستخدام SSO، لذا فإن جميع مستخدمي موقعي موجودون بالفعل في قاعدة بيانات موقعي.
السؤال هو، كيف يمكنني إضافة مستخدمين من موقعي إلى منتدى discourse عبر API؟ وكيف يمكنني التحقق مما إذا كان المستخدم قد تمت إضافته بالفعل؟
شكراً لك
لكي يتمكن المستخدم من استخدام Discourse، يجب أن يكون مسجلاً دخوله.
مع SSO، يتم إنشاء حساب جديد عند محاولة تسجيل الدخول إذا لم يكن موجودًا بالفعل، فلماذا لا تدعه يحدث بشكل طبيعي؟
أفترض أنك تستخدم DiscourseConnect ؟:
DiscourseConnect is a core Discourse feature that allows you to configure “Single Sign-On (SSO)” to completely outsource all user registration and login from Discourse to another site. Offered to our pro, business and enterprise hosting customers .
(Feb 2021) ‘Discourse SSO ’ is now ‘DiscourseConnect ’. If you are running an old version of Discourse, the settings below will be named sso_... rather than discourse_connect_...
The Problem
Many sites wishing to integrate wit…
إعجابَين (2)
لا يمكنني السماح بحدوث ذلك بشكل طبيعي حيث قد يستخدم المستخدمون موقعي دون زيارة المنتدى. ما أردته هو الاستفادة من ميزة النشرة الإخبارية والإشعارات في Discourse، موقعي يدور حول المختبر الافتراضي، حيث يقضي المستخدمون وقتهم في بناء الأشياء دون الحاجة إلى زيارة المنتدى.